There will be a German dub?Ive seen someone on reddit point out that if the movie doesnt get an age rating in time, itll automatically be considered 18+, meaning that in many countries minors wont be allowed into the theatre even with a parent accompanying them
And indie movies usually have a delay in getting a rating, no? It certainly doesnt have a rating yet on my local cinemas website.
And if it gets rated something like 15+ at least in the UK youd have to show your ID for entry still. Unsure on if theyd allow the ipad toddlers who mainly know TADC through contentfarm slop into a 13+ movie tho if they have their parents with them, in the UK yes but others like Germany tend to be suuuper strict.
Edit:
Germany moment, even if its rated 12+ anyone under 6 gets turned away and between 6-11 need to go with either a parent or with another adult with a printed and filled out permission form. And the next rating is a hard 16+ which doesnt allow any under 16's, which is a very likely rating for it to have if it ends with mass suicide.
